Thermal performance: EPS foam keeps drinks hot up to 6 hours

Independent ASTM-certified testing confirms EPS foam cups from Dart Container deliver top-tier insulation thanks to their closed-cell structure with millions of micro-bubbles.

  • R-value: EPS foam cup R = 0.9 vs single-wall paper cup R = 0.3 (3× better insulation).
  • Temperature retention (16 oz hot coffee, 85°C start, 22°C ambient): after 6 hours, EPS ~38°C; paper ~22°C.
  • Comfort: EPS outer wall ~40°C when filled with 85°C coffee—no sleeve needed.
  • Weight: EPS ~5.2 g vs paper ~10.5 g—lighter for logistics and waste handling.
ASTM C177 results (TEST-DART-001): “Dart EPS cup R-0.9 outperformed paper by 3×; after 6 hours, the EPS cup remained warm at ~38°C.”

Food contact safety: FDA compliance, NSF migration testing

Consumer safety is non-negotiable. Dart Container’s EPS products comply with FDA 21 CFR 177.1640 and have been evaluated by NSF International for styrene monomer migration under worst-case laboratory conditions.

  • Styrene migration in hot/acidic simulant at 100°C for 2 hours: ~0.8 ppb.
  • FDA threshold: < 5000 ppb. Dart is ~6,250× below the limit.
  • Normal coffee use (85°C, 30 minutes): < 0.1 ppb (below detection limit).
NSF data (TEST-DART-002): “Measured styrene from Dart EPS containers was ~0.8 ppb versus the FDA safety threshold of 5000 ppb.”

Total Cost of Ownership (TCO): sleeves, storage, waste—count every dollar

Procurement decisions should account for hidden costs beyond unit price. EPS foam cups usually cost less than paper when you add sleeves, storage, and waste fees.

  • Unit price example (16 oz): EPS ~$0.05 vs paper ~$0.08 (EPS 38% less).
  • Sleeves: EPS 0% required vs paper 100% at ~$0.02 each—significant annual spend for chains.
  • Storage: EPS nested stacks halve the cubic volume versus most paper/PP stacks—lower warehousing costs.
  • Waste: lighter EPS reduces tonnage fees; a 50-store chain selling 5 million cups/year sees measurable savings.

Independent consulting (RESEARCH-DART-001) shows a 50-location coffee chain selling 5 million cups annually can reach:

  • EPS TCO: ~$341,250
  • Paper TCO: ~$682,500 (EPS ~50% lower)
  • PP TCO: ~$532,000 (EPS ~36% lower)

Environmental reality and action: recycling, compression, regional policy

EPS faces an environmental controversy: in the U.S., EPS recycling rates remain below 2%, and some cities and states have enacted restrictions. Dart Container acknowledges the gap and invests in solutions rather than ignoring the problem.

  • Compression: Dart-backed programs compact EPS to ~1/50 original volume, reducing transport costs.
  • Recovery network: expanding collection sites with foodservice partners, campuses, and airports.
  • Circular goals: increasing use of recycled EPS and exploring materials innovations.
CONT-DART-001: “EPS is 100% recyclable; the core challenge is infrastructure and economics. Dart is building a broader recovery network while supporting regional compliance.”

Bottom line: where recovery infrastructure exists, EPS often shows a lower carbon footprint than paper in LCA studies; where it does not, operators may opt for regionally compliant alternatives. Dart helps navigate those choices without sacrificing performance.

Quick comparison: EPS vs paper for hot cups

  • Comfort: EPS ~40°C outer wall at 85°C fill; paper often requires sleeves.
  • Insulation: EPS R = 0.9; paper R = 0.3 (single) or ~0.6 (double).
  • TCO: EPS eliminates sleeve spend and cuts storage volume; paper adds sleeve cost and uses more storage.
  • Waste: EPS lighter tonnage; paper heavier but may have regionally favored policies.
